METHOD OF FIXING FLEXIBLE THIN FILM SOLAR CELL AND THIN FILM SOLAR CELL INTEGRATED STRUCTURE
PROBLEM TO BE SOLVED: To provide a method for fixing a flexible thin film solar cell module to a structure with a simple structure.SOLUTION: Provided is a method for fixing a flexible thin film solar cell module and a structure via a linear member fixed to the structure. The structure and the linear member are fixed at a plurality of positions.SELECTED DRAWING: Figure 1
